NJ Transit Strike Would Be ‘Disaster’ for Region, Sherrill Says
New Jersey Transit is on the brink of a “huge crisis” as a train engineers strike threatens to upend commutes as early as May 16, according to US Representative Mikie Sherrill.

Impact on Commuters
The anticipated NJ Transit strike could disrupt the lives of many commuters who depend on buses and trains for their travel to work, school, and other essential activities. With reduced transportation options, many find themselves facing lengthy delays and the added stress of finding alternative ways to reach their destinations. The ripple effect of a strike could result in economic repercussions for local businesses, which often thrive on the daily influx of commuters.
